    FALMOUTH -- Frank went home to be with his Lord and Savior at Sedgwood Commons in Falmouth on Monday, Oct. 13, 2014. Frank was born in Portland on Nov. 27, 1924, and lived on a dairy farm in Prides Corner as the third generation farm family. He was the third child of Frank and Annie Oulton. At the age of four, Frank and his family moved to Cumberland where he eventually took over the dairy farm with his brother, Edward Oulton. On Sept. 23, 1950, Frank married Evelyn Maxwell and had five children.
    He was predeceased by his wife Evelyn, of 59 years; his sisters, Mary Norton and Dorothy Gould; and by his oldest daughter, Diane Roberge in March of 2013. He is survived by his brother, Edward Oulton and his wife Barbara of Cumberland; his daughters, Nancy Smith of Cumberland, Sarah Lavelle and her husband Paul of Colorado Springs, Colo., and Eleanor Berry of Cumberland. He is also survived by his son, Paul Oulton and his wife Betsy of Falmouth. He is lovingly remembered by his grandchildren, Stephanie and John Foley, Heather and Marc Gordon, Chris and Sarah Charlton, Stacey and Anthony Baker, Heidi Charlton, James and Elana Charlton, Lindsey Lavelle, and Greg Oulton; and great-grandchildren, Kailey Foley, Liam, Zoe and Aoife Gordon and Maxwell Charlton.
    He was a member of the North Deering Alliance Church in Portland where he lovingly served as a deacon and usher for many years. After the dairy farm was sold to become the Falmouth Country Club in 1986, Frank was able to continue to work the land as a groundskeeper for the golf course until he was 85 years old.

    GA - Attending school in 1871.

    One record shows E. Albert buried in South Portland, ME; Moved to US ca 1905 to Skowhegan ME, then to Prides Corner in Westbrook, ME for a short time, before finally moving to Wynn Road in Cumberland Center, ME to live with his son Frank onJuly 4, 1928. He led the choir for many years in Jolicure, and also in the Methodist church in Skowhegan, ME. He continued in that role at Prides Corner. His mind was clear to the end of his life, and was hard working, taking great pride in work well done.

    Edward had deep blue eyes, according to Annie Gifford Oulton.

    I have photos taken in 1981 of the old home that collapsed near Oulton Corner in Jolicure, NB that was his home, and his parent's before him. It was out in the middle of a field and accessible by a narrow lane from the main highway. See the note at Annie Gertrude Hicks for a description of the house.

    The farm was one half of his father's (Edward Samson Oulton) farm, with Busby Oulton owning the other half with the original buildings.

    According to Annie Gifford Oulton, this date was January 8, 1930. Dorothy Gertrude Oulton Gould has the date as January 18, 1930.

    He was chilled and overstressed by helping to clear fallen limbs and trees after the sleet and ice storm of January, 1930. With a weak heart, he came down with pneumonia and died. He was cared for by Annie Gifford Oulton to the end.

    GA - Annie had dark eyes and hair- her eyes were a dark agate, according to Annie Gifford Oulton. She had beautiful small hands despite the hard work on the farm in Jolicure. Their house was small where they lived when first married, but Albert "was a good provider. There was wood for the stove and under the kitchen floor was a 'root cellar' where he had stored vegatables, turnips, potatoes, etc. and a barrel of pork. A ladder led to the root cellar with a trap door cut in the kitchen floor. Albert was working all the time on the outbuildings. Albert had built by himself the main house added to the ell by the time Mabel Durexa was born. The house was insulated with moss gathered from the edge of the marsh. Doubled lathed and plastered, it was a sturdy home with hand-made scroll work and a bay window where Annie kept many plants. They had a piano in one front room, and an organ in the other.

    Annie and Albert took care of Annie's mother in her final days.

    Annie suffered a stroke in 1928/29, and a broken arm during the summer of 1929, just before her husband Albert died. She stayed some of the time with her daughter Mabel.
